          It comes down to the same questions: Have you updated AGPS and given the watch some minutes in the pre-start screen to establish a good set of active satellites? A regular amateur freestyle swimming style should be sufficient.

              Technically the following is happening with GNSS reception:

              The satellites continuously send out their position data and time stamps. The watch (with an incredibly small antenna to actually receive signals from space) tries to lock on those transmissions. It uses assumptions, where the satellites should be and which satellites to look for (from the AGPS data updates daily). Still those assumptions are just the starting point, and subsequently one after the other satellite is taken into the equation to calculate the current position. The data rate is pretty slow and the receiver needs to read the time stamps, the satellites are sending.
              Position fix is possible, when a connection to 4 or 5 satellites is established. This is, when the arrow in the watch becomes green. Still, if the connection to one or more satellites is broken, the position fix will be dropped. This can easily happen if the satellite is just above the horizon, or if you move the watch antenna away facing a different direction. Thus it is crucial, that the watch is able to follow the transmissions of as many satellites as possible.
              For outdoor activities usually the watch can still lock on more data streams while the activity has already started.

              In the water, there is no GPS reception, as the satellite signals don’t penetrate water. This means, that the watch only has fractions of a second, to read data from the (badly positioned) antenna that has super weak signals to acquire from satellites far away in space, before it is submerged again.

              You can help the process by waiting after the green arrow comes on. Green arrow means, the watch uses at least 4 satellites. Waiting longer ensures, that more satellites are added into the equation. If some are lost later, others can be used. 2-3 minutes is a good starting point.

              Plus you need to bring the watch above the water level periodically for it to continue calculation your position. Breast stroke is not really suitable for this.

              Conclusion: If you had good results in the past with not much waiting and swimming breaststroke, it is almost a miracle.
